What companies run services between Aime, France and Geneva, Switzerland?

You can take a train from Aime La Plagne to Geneve via Chambery Challes Les Eaux in around 3h 48m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Aime - La Plagne to Geneva - Bus Station via Chambéry - Bus Station in around 3h 57m.
